&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;New page&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;=About the song=&lt;br /&gt;
This is a cheer that [[Mike Joseph]] &amp;#039;07 introduced to the band. It was written down for posterity by [[Chris Behrens]] &amp;#039;08.&lt;br /&gt;
=Instrumentation requirements=&lt;br /&gt;
At least one sousaphone. The rest of the band is tacet.&lt;br /&gt;
=History=&lt;br /&gt;
This cheer is traditionally played by one or more sousaphones as the last thing the band plays at a game. In a victory it is played after [[398 - Hey! Baby!|Hey! Baby!]], and in a loss or a tie it is played after [[041 - Hail, Dear Old Rensselaer|Hail]].&lt;br /&gt;
